Dark Chocolate Mousse

Step by Step Instructions

Step 1
Soak the gelatin sheet in cold water until soften.

Step 2
Bring half of the whipping cream to simmer, add the gelatin sheet and mix together.

Step 3
Add the cream mixture into the chocolate pieces and mix well.

Step 4
Whip the remaining whipping cream until soft peak and fold it into the chocolate mixture.

Step 5
Place the mousse ring on the chocolate cake and set still. Fill the chocolate mousse about half of the ring.

Step 6
Place another slice of the chocolate cake about one size down and refrigerated for 20 minutes.

Step 7
Remove from the fridge and fill the chocolate mousse until the height of the ring and refrigerated again for an hour.

Step 8
Heat up the whipping cream and the glucose syrup. Add the cream mixture into the chocolate pieces and stir until the chocolate is melted. Let cool and set aside.

Step 9
Remove the mold from the chocolate mousse and refrigerate for 10 minutes.

Step 10
Pour the chocolate glaze over the chocolate mousse until the glaze is set. Garnish and ready to serve.
